We get paid to be right all the time, to have the answers when other don't. I love being right. It drives me. But it's driving my relationships into the ground. Anyone have any good advice?

First, shut up. Listen. Dont speak after listening. Second, be willing to be wrong. Ive been in similar situation. My wife would bring me her problems and I would start solving them, when all she wanted was for me to be there and listen. Be quick to listen and slow to speak. Ask, dont tell. If you think they dont have all the facts, ask about why they feel or think that way without pointing out you think their wrong. You become involved in their life by asking and being curious about them, not by telling them.

Understand that there are two parts of the brain: emotional and logical. Youre choosing to only think and use logical. Most people are not like that and often heavily skewed to using emotional. When you do that to others, in an attempt to present facts and challenge their findings, youre in fact hurting their emotional side causing pain. They associate you with that pain. You probably are not like that & when someone challenges you, you dont feel bad, you only feel logically challenged. But most people arent like that. And to succeed, you must tap into the emotional side

We don't get paid to be right all the time. Baseball players who get a hit .300 are celebrated. We get paid to provide the voice of reason for a client who's lost it. Set the expectation up front. I will not be right all of the time. I will be available and give you a reason not to just bury your money in the back yard. Managing expectations a crucial part of any relationship and is seldom covered. Expectations
Must be mentally created, verbalized, realistic, agreed upon, if any of those is missing conflict will ensue.

In relationships - personal and business, if you want people to like you, you need to help them like you. Don't make them feel they are wrong all the time. Help them win, make them feel good and positive about themselves and you'll always come out ahead. It's not about you, it's about them, don't be narcissistic.
